[Using "number needed to treat" to interpret treatment effect].

Summary

Evidence-based medicine (EBM) is revolutionizing healthcare. Understanding absolute measures like the number needed to treat (NNT) is crucial for informed clinical decisions.

Context:

  • Evidence-based medicine (EBM) is a transformative paradigm in contemporary healthcare.
  • Randomized controlled trials (RCTs) are the benchmark for assessing therapeutic interventions.

Purpose:

  • To elucidate the significance of absolute measures in evaluating treatment efficacy.
  • To highlight the importance of the number needed to treat (NNT) for rational clinical decision-making.

Summary:

  • Treatment effects are quantified using relative (e.g., relative risk) and absolute measures.
  • Absolute measures, such as absolute risk reduction and NNT, are more clinically meaningful as they incorporate baseline risk and benefit.
  • The NNT, calculated as the reciprocal of absolute risk reduction, provides a practical estimate of treatment impact.

Impact:

  • Promotes a deeper understanding of treatment effectiveness beyond relative comparisons.
  • Enhances the rational application of clinical evidence in patient care.
  • Emphasizes the need for comprehensive data interpretation, including baseline risk and follow-up duration, when assessing NNT values.
